I've hunted that area a lot and pretty much know it like the back of my hand. Which tag did you draw? East or West of 4 mile road?

The West of 4 mile road is a difficult hunt and if you don't find a land owner to put you on elk you most likely will not be successful. The east of 4 mile hunt is primarily weather dependent. If we get early snows that bring the elk down there will be elk all over the place and you should have no trouble filling tags. If we don't get the snows then it is a very difficult hunt. When I draw that hunt, I usually don't even put out much effort until the last week........

Based on the description you attached, you have the better of the 2 hunts. Dodson Pass is not a bad place to look for elk but if you hunt there you need to realize that only 1 side of road will be open (south). North side of Dodson is 32A and is a different hunt. I've seen people breaking the law there a few times, but I didn't have cell service and wasn't close enough to get plate numbers. Dodson is one of the cross over points when the elk come down. If there is enough snow to push the elk down, then it is a good place to be first thing in the morning.

Like I said, if there is enough snow to push the elk down, you won't have trouble finding them. If there is not enough snow, then it will be a very difficult hunt.
